Expert Review
UPS positions itself as a leader in package delivery, but working as a package handler can be quite demanding. The physical nature of the job requires stamina, and employees often face long hours during peak seasons. Expect to be on your feet for the majority of your shift, loading and unloading packages, which can be repetitive.
While the company offers growth opportunities, it’s essential to consider the work-life balance. Shifts may vary significantly, and overtime is common, particularly during busy periods like holidays. This unpredictability can be challenging for those with family commitments or other jobs.
Customer service reputation is generally positive, with many employees appreciating the teamwork and support from colleagues.
